网站在设计和生产过程中以及发布后都会出现这样的问题,有些问题很容易解决,有些问题会困扰我们很长一段时间,左找右找不到问题的症结所在。但是,如果你有一种系统的方法来分析问题,这不是更容易吗?今天,小编就给大家介绍一下网站中存在的问题,如何尽快解决。
1、查看HTML代码
通常,当我们的开发人员发现网页有问题时,要做的就是验证HTML代码。虽然验证HTML可能有很多原因,但当遇到问题时,验证HTML代码是首要任务。
2、验证CSS代码
下一个比较有可能导致问题的地方是CSS代码。CSS的验证就像HTML的验证一样。如果验证中出现错误,则表示您的CSS工作正常,并且网页问题不是由CSS引起的。
3、验证JavaScript或其他动态元素
与HTML和CSS一样,如果您的网站使用JavaScript、PHP、JSP或其他动态元素,请确保它们是可访问和本地化的。
4、测试浏览器兼容性
某些问题可能会出现在特定的浏览器中,因此您可能需要在不同的浏览器上测试您的网站。如果问题在所有浏览器中都是一样的,它会告诉问题在哪里,您可以直接解决。如果问题是特定浏览器独有的,并且无法解决,您可以为该浏览器创建样式表或备用页。
5、简化页面
如果验证HTML/CSS不起作用,那么您需要简化页面查找。要做到这一点,比较简单的方法是删除页面的部分内容,直到找到问题为止,并相应地简化CSS。简化页面并不意味着实际删除页面内容,而是找到问题并解决它。
先减后加
一旦你发现了问题,你就需要消除症状。例如,如果您已经将问题缩小到一个特定的和相应的CSS样式代码,那么逐行删除CSS,看看问题是否已经解决。很快你就会看到这个问题并知道如何解决它。在解决它后,将删除的代码添加回来,并确保再次测试该网站,看看它是否有效。任何创建网站的人都知道,一个小小的改变就能带来巨大的不同。如果你每次更新网站时都不测试哪怕是看似微小的更改,那么当稍后出现问题时,你将很难弄清楚出了什么问题。
首先设计符合标准的浏览器
工程师遇到的比较常见的问题是让网站在大多数浏览器中看起来一致。尽管这很难实现,但仍有许多网页设计工程师在努力实现这一目标。在这种情况下,您需要设计一个符合标准的浏览器,如Firefox。一旦它在Firefox上运行,您就可以将其应用于其他浏览器。
保持代码清洁
一旦你发现并解决了这个问题,你就需要提高警惕,防止它再次出现。处理这个问题比较简单的方法是压缩HTML和CSS代码。这里并不是说需要降低网站的要求,而是说需要用更简单的代码编写方法来取代复杂的代码。